How much do entry level research associate j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 21, 2026, the average hourly pay for entry level research associate in Arizona is $22.37,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.00 and $28.71 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an entry level research associate?

An Entry Level Research Associate supports research projects by collecting, analyzing, and interpreting data under the supervision of senior researchers. They assist with literature reviews, laboratory experiments, data entry, and documentation. This role is common in academic, healthcare, and corporate research settings, providing hands-on experience in research methodologies. Str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and proficiency with research tools are essential. It is an excellent starting point for those looking to build a career in research or related fields.

What does an entry level research associate do?

A typical day for an Entry Level Research Associate involves a mix of tasks such as collecting and analyzing data, preparing samples, maintaining lab equipment, and assisting with literature reviews. You’ll often collaborate closely with senior researchers and team members to coordinate experiments and interpret findings. Depending on the project, you may also be responsible for documenting results and contributing to group meetings or presentations. The work environment is usually team-oriented and fast-paced, offering great opportunities to learn a variety of research methods and tools. This dynamic role allows you to gain hands-on experience and build foundational skills for advancement in scientific or academic research.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the entry level research associate position?

To thrive as an Entry Level Research Associate, you need a bachelor’s degree in a science-related field, strong analytical skills, and experience with data collection and laboratory procedures. Familiarity with lab equipment, statistical analysis software (such as SPSS or R), and basic data management systems is typically required. Effective communication, organization, and attention to detail are key soft skills that help you excel in this role. These competencies ensure accurate research support, reliable results, and smooth collaboration within multidisciplinary research teams.

Job description

Overview

Kimley-Horn is seeking an entry level Survey Analyst to join our Scottsdale, Arizona (AZ) office to support our project managers in survey design related tasks. This is not a remote position. 

Responsibilities
  • Utilize AutoCAD Civil 3D software to produce detailed subdivision maps, ALTA surveys, topographic surveys, and other various survey related maps or exhibits.
  • Research boundary and easement title documents and perform boundary analysis.
  • Use field crew data files (points), field sketches, photos and reference maps to create surveys.
  • Prepare legal descriptions and exhibits for right of way, easements, acquisition parcels, etc.
  • Additional responsibilities and/or duties as assigned
Qualifications
  • Associate or Bachelors Degree preferred
  • Working knowledge of AutoCAD Civil3D
  • Strong communication and technical skills
  • Ability to work independently and in a team environment
  • Ability to manage multiple projects at one time
